This standard includes technical requirements, test principles, test methods, inspection rules, labeling, packaging, transportation and storage, etc., to make a more comprehensive and systematic evaluation of product safety and effectiveness, and to unify technical parameters. The standard uses simulated blood samples for testing as quality controls to measure the reaction time (R) required from the blood sample to the formation of the first detectable blood clot, the blood clot formation time (K), and the blood clot formation time (K). The gradually formed dynamic characteristic value (ANG) and maximum amplitude (MA) have an accuracy range that is better than or equal to similar foreign products.
